It's our goal here at Indigo Bridge to find a little something for everyone - and that includes finding something for every little one! Our guided summer-long reading programs offer inspiration for young scientists & environmentalists, puzzles for your budding detective, fairy tales both fractured & traditional, & so much more! All Indigo guided Summer Reading Programs are free of charge, open to the public, and designed for children ages 5-10. Plus, Indigo's Growing through Reading passport allows older children - or those with busy summer schedules! - to earn prizes & explore the environment through literature while reading at their own pace throughout the summer.
